The Metaphor of the Morning Light

Langa, established in 1927, is more than just a historical site; it is a profound metaphor for the nation itself. It is the place where the shadows of the past were fought with unyielding community spirit, where artists, musicians, and thinkers laid the foundation for the freedom we see today.

If the Cape Peninsula represents the magnificent, beautiful exterior, then Langa represents the vital, beating heart—the source of the energy that drives the city forward. Paying Respects: Trading Sightseeing for Soul

Our Langa experience is not a tour; it is an act of paying respects and engaging in an essential cultural exchange. This is where you trade the role of a detached spectator for that of an active participant:

  1. The Humility of History: Stand near the former Langa Pass Office, feeling the weight of the regulations that sought to crush the human spirit, and then witness the current vibrant marketplace that has blossomed in its place. This duality of pain and progress is the ultimate lesson in resilience.
  2. The Light of Ubuntu: The spirit of Ubuntu (humanity towards others) shines brightest here. You’ll find it in the genuine smile of your Langa resident guide, in the offer to share traditional Umqombothi in a local home, and in the overwhelming sense of shared humanity that transcends language barriers.
  3. The Gospel’s Glory: To experience a Sunday service or a joint rehearsal with a local Langa Gospel Choir is to feel the power of collective hope. The music is not just sound; it is the raw, electric energy of transformation, a melody that truly captures the light rising over hardship.
